## Deployment

Splitvane, the A/B experiment assignment service, deploys as a stateless pod set behind the Thornmere router. Plugin authors must target the assignment API version pinned at deploy time; mixed versions cause bucketing skew. Assignments are deterministic per user key, so restarts are safe. The standard deployment ships with the configuration shown below.

deployment values, bahof-badug:
[rusix]
team = zorok
access_code = ac_641cbe
owner = ulair.tamius
host = rusix.torvasoft.local
port = 5672
peer = ulaix.sivrelworks.internal
salt = 1df570ed
pin = 6327

Ticket: DEDUP-412 — Connection failures during customer record dedup

The Larkspur dedup job started failing overnight with pool exhaustion errors. It merges duplicate customer records in batches of 500, but the batch worker isn't releasing connections after a merge conflict, so the pool drains within twenty minutes. Proposed fix: wrap merges in a try/finally release and cap retries at three. For the sync, reproduce against staging using the connection string below.

primary connection of bagep-kaweg = clickhouse://rusdor_svc:3TXlgH7O8DuUYI@db-ae3f.zarqelgrid.internal:5432/zordor

Ticket #—Missed pick-up, antique clock

Hey coordination desk — the Fairleigh longcase clock was supposed to go out to Ambrose Clockworks yesterday afternoon, but the driver never showed at the Tindermere depot. The restorer is holding the workshop slot until tomorrow, so we really need this rebooked for the morning run. The clock is crated and sitting by bay 2, paperwork taped on top. For whoever takes the job, here's the note on the hand-over.

courier memo of yawep-yafog: the pramir ulaix courier leaves the ulavan aldix frair zorok oliiel joreth rusdor fenvan ledger at gate 1305 under passcode 514738

### Runbook Fragment: StockSquare Reconciliation Job

The StockSquare inventory reconciliation job runs nightly and compares warehouse counts against the ledger service. Before releasing a new job version, run the dry-run mode against the previous night's snapshot and confirm the discrepancy report matches the baseline within tolerance. If counts diverge, stop and escalate — do not deploy over an unexplained delta. Once the dry run is clean, build the release artifact and sign it so the scheduler will accept it. Sign using the key below.

signing key of bagap-yawep = bky13_TbfT6ZMUoGJo2